•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

关于蓝牙模块HC-05和手机连接成功后 发送信号,单片机没有

aea3dc7ae5c858de 2020-09-23 浏览量:1310
手机和蓝牙模块连接成功以后,发送信号,单片机没有反应,这是为什么呀,大神求解
0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 手机和蓝牙连接了,单片机咋连接的?


    如果是蓝牙连的单片机:

    1.首先检查数据格式是否对,

      波特率,停止位,起始位,校验位

    2.连接是否对?

      RX,TX有否接反

    3.蓝牙是否收到数据?

      可以用串口调试工具+usb转串口TTL检查

    4.单片机对数据处理是否对?

     可以单片机把收到的蓝牙数据再输出或显示到某个地方,比如另外串口,LED,显示屏等

    • 发布于 2020-09-25
    • 举报
    • 评论 0
    • 0
    • 0

其他答案 数量:4
  • 先确定HC--05出于接收模式,

    再通过USB转串口把HC-05接到电脑上,通过串口助手检查一下是否有数据输入

    最后将HC-05与单片机连接,注意波特率和接线问题,

    这时候可以通过另一个串口将与蓝牙连接的串口接收的的数据打印出来,通过串口助手检查是否接收到数据

    • 发布于2020-09-25
    • 举报
    • 评论 0
    • 0
    • 0

  • 因为模块是通过串口与单片机连接,所以其实可以先判断模块收发是否有问题,这个可以在电脑等上先行测试,用串口设备连接模块,测试完成后才真正与单片机连接,排除模块和蓝牙连接方面问题

    在前述基础上,再来判断单片机连接问题:

    1. 端口连接接线是否正确

    2. 模块供电是否正确

    3. 单片机相应程序串口设置是否正确(波特率、通信模式等等)


    • 发布于2020-09-25
    • 举报
    • 评论 0
    • 0
    • 0

  • 这个要看程序怎么实现的,一般HC05使用的是串口交互,测试阶段建议将HC05接到电脑串口上面查看交互的信息
    • 发布于2020-09-26
    • 举报
    • 评论 0
    • 0
    • 0

  • 如果你的硬件没问题,那么需要看你的程序才能知道你的问题所在。
    • 发布于2020-10-06
    • 举报
    • 评论 0
    • 0
    • 0

相关问题

问题达人换一批

关于蓝牙模块HC-05和手机连接成功后 发送信号,单片机没有